July leads for comfortable weather in Torekov: typically 20.9°C by day, 15.2°C at night, with 70 mm of rain. Based on measured 1991–2020 NOAA station history.

The weakest month is January, scoring 5 against July’s 79 — days reach only 2.5°C, 21° below the 24°C the score treats as ideal.
Month by month
The bars show the comfort score. Day and night temperatures come from daily observed highs and lows; rain is the historical monthly estimate.
| Month | Day | Night | Rain | Wet days | Sea | Daylight | Comfort | Coverage |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| January | 2.5°C | -0.5°C | 47 mm | 10.6 | 2.8°C | 7 h 28 | 5 | Good coverage |
| February | 2.6°C | -0.6°C | 39 mm | 8.8 | 2.0°C | 9 h 25 | 5 | Good coverage |
| March | 5°C | 0.6°C | 34 mm | 7.8 | 3.0°C | 11 h 37 | 7 | Good coverage |
| April | 10.5°C | 4.4°C | 32 mm | 6.7 | 6.5°C | 14 h 07 | 33 | Strong coverage |
| May | 15.3°C | 8.8°C | 47 mm | 8.6 | 11.2°C | 16 h 21 | 53 | Strong coverage |
| June | 18.7°C | 12.7°C | 69 mm | 9.5 | 15.3°C | 17 h 41 | 68 | Strong coverage |
| July | 20.9°C | 15.2°C | 70 mm | 9.2 | 17.9°C | 17 h 08 | 79 | Strong coverage |
| August | 21°C | 15.3°C | 85 mm | 11.1 | 18.4°C | 15 h 08 | 75 | Strong coverage |
| September | 17.3°C | 12.3°C | 55 mm | 9.3 | 15.5°C | 12 h 40 | 65 | Strong coverage |
| October | 12.2°C | 8.5°C | 64 mm | 11.3 | 11.6°C | 10 h 16 | 38 | Strong coverage |
| November | 7.5°C | 4.5°C | 53 mm | 10.6 | 7.9°C | 8 h 04 | 17 | Strong coverage |
| December | 4.4°C | 1.4°C | 54 mm | 11.7 | 4.9°C | 6 h 53 | 5 | Good coverage |

| Month | Warm & dry days | Wet days | Washouts | Week with 3+ wet days | Daytime mean has ranged |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| January | 0% | 33% | 3% | 45% | 0.2–4.7°C |
| February | 0% | 29% | 2% | 36% | -0.5–5.0°C |
| March | 0% | 23% | 1% | 27% | 1.8–7.5°C |
| April | 1% | 24% | 2% | 27% | 7.4–12.2°C |
| May | 10% | 26% | 3% | 31% | 12.6–16.7°C |
| June | 23% | 29% | 5% | 38% | 16.7–21.1°C |
| July | 41% | 31% | 7% | 40% | 18.2–23.1°C |
| August | 37% | 35% | 9% | 46% | 18.4–22.9°C |
| September | 13% | 30% | 5% | 38% | 15.9–19.6°C |
| October | <1% | 35% | 5% | 46% | 10.8–13.8°C |
| November | 0% | 35% | 3% | 46% | 6.0–8.9°C |
| December | 0% | 37% | 4% | 51% | 2.2–6.3°C |
A warm and dry day reaches 20°C with under 1 mm of rain; a wet day gets 1 mm or more; a washout gets 10 mm or more. The week column is the share of seven-day stretches in that month, across the station’s whole daily record, that contained three or more wet days — the odds a week-long trip is rained on repeatedly, counted rather than modelled. The last column is the 10th to 90th percentile of that month’s daytime average across individual years: a narrow band means the average is what you will get, a wide one means the average is a midpoint between years that felt quite different.
